Abstract
The invention relates to a method for designing a warning system database, and belongs to the technical field of process control. The database is divided into user management, site management, data storage and warning storage. The user management is personal information of maintaining and managing persons, permission information and operation information of the managing persons; the site management is position information of sites and information of devices in the sites; the data storage comprises device information data analyzed at a sensor terminal; the warning storage comprises arranged warning values and alarming data during device warning. When being received, the sensor data are compared with a warning threshold value in the warning storage in real time; once warning occurs, the database instantly gives out warning to the managing persons through a foreground. After the warning is processed by the managing persons, the managing persons log into the foreground to conduct confirmation, and operation information is directly stored into the database. By means of the method, responsibilities of the managing persons can be clearer, the device quality can be known more visually by inquiring historical data lists and daily statistical tables, the application service life of the devices is forecasted, and the jurisdictional limit of the managing persons can be arranged more reasonably.

The present invention is realized by following concrete technical scheme.
A method for designing for warning system database, this database comprises user management, station field signal, and data store and alarm storage area, and wherein user management is personal information and the authority information of maintenance management personnel; Station field signal is the information of equipment in the positional information of website and website; Data storage mainly contains the facility information data that sensor side is resolved; Alarm storage mainly contains alarm data during warning value and the equipment alarm of setting, and this method for designing step is as follows:
A, user management: store customer management information with four relation tables, respectively: department information table, user message table, equipment authority list and menu authority list, department information table comprises department's id information and department name information; User message table comprises that information is user ID, department ID, user's login name, user log in password, user mobile phone number, subscriber mailbox information, equipment authority list associates with user message table, mainly specify that managerial personnel are responsible for the equipment in which region, the information that equipment authority list comprises is equipment permission ID, region ID and device id information; Menu authority list associates with user message table, and after mainly specifying that managerial personnel log in front page layout, operable authority, comprises information: menu permission ID, pad name;
B, station field signal: use zone information table, site information table and facility information table to carry out admin site information, zone information table is higher level's table of site information table, and zone information table comprises information: region ID, zone name; Site information table comprises information: Site ID, region ID, site name; Facility information table associates with site information table, the facility information under each website of main storage, and comprising information has: device id, Site ID, device name, device type;
C, data store: the data of mainly recording unit sensor collection, store with three tables: sensor setting table, real time data table and historical data table, sensor setting table associates with the facility information table of station field signal part, mainly distinguish the observed data title of each sensor of equipment and relevant conversion formula, as humidity data, sensor general measure be voltage or electric current, now change with formula, sensor setting table comprises information: sensor setting ID, device id, sensor name, sensing data type, conversion formula; Real time data table associates with sensor setting table, and the data of main real-time update sensor, comprise information: real time data ID, sensor setting ID, sensor real time data; Historical data table associates with real time data table, the data of main storage sensor, and historical data table comprises information: historical data ID, real time data ID, sensor historic data;
D, alarm store: essential record warning information, three tables are used to store: alarm arranges table, Real-time Alarm table and history alarm table, alarm arranges table and associates with the real time data table of data storage section, be mainly used to arrange alarm threshold, it comprises information: alarm arranges ID, real time data ID, lower alarm threshold value and upper alarm threshold value; Real-time Alarm table also associates with real time data table, the warning information of real-time update equipment and the treatment state of alarm equipment, Real-time Alarm table comprises information: Real-time Alarm ID, real time data ID, alarm start time, acknowledged alarm time, alarm end time, acknowledged alarm people and warning value; The warning information of history alarm table essential record equipment and the treatment state of alarm equipment, history alarm table comprises information: history alarm ID, Real-time Alarm ID, alarm start time, acknowledged alarm time, alarm end time, acknowledged alarm people and warning value;
E, there is the User operation log table of assisted user administrative section in addition, it associates with facility information table with user message table, essential record manager works schedule, it comprises information: User operation log ID, user ID, user's landing time, user's logout time; The historical data day statistical form that auxiliary data storage area needs, the essential record image data mean value of one day, historical data day statistical form comprise information: historical data day statistics ID, real time data ID and sensor historic statistical average;
The real time data of the continuous update station point sensor of real time data table of above-mentioned data storage section, and compared with the alarm threshold that the alarm of alarm storage area is arranged in table by the sensor setting table of association, if alarm, warning information is stored in Real-time Alarm table, and notify the managerial personnel in this region, by the time after alarm equipment is handled well, warning information is stored in history alarm table, and upgrade Real-time Alarm table, managerial personnel log in foreground and confirm that equipment is fixed, and operation information is stored in User operation log table;
While renewal real time data table, data are stored in historical data, write an operation in a database, morning every day is added up to the data day of historical data table on time, and data are stored in day statistical form.
